Convertiți programatic MHTML în PDF utilizând Node.js. Explorați puterea Node.js pentru o conversie eficientă și scalabilă de la MHTML la PDF.
Pentru dezvoltatorii JavaScript care caută o soluție perfectă pentru a converti MHTML în PDF, Aspose.Words for Node.js via .NET oferă un API de conversie a fișierelor intuitiv și simplu. Soluția noastră permite dezvoltatorilor JavaScript să convertească cu ușurință fișierele dintr-un format în altul, făcându-l un instrument indispensabil pentru automatizarea sarcinilor de conversie a fișierelor.
Indiferent dacă lucrați cu MHTML, PDF sau alte formate de fișiere, Aspose.Words for Node.js via .NET le acoperă pe toate și asigură rezultate de cea mai înaltă calitate. Testați cum funcționează codul JavaScript cu fișierele dvs. MHTML chiar acum.
Următorul exemplu demonstrează cum să convertiți MHTML în PDF cu doar câteva linii de cod JavaScript. Începeți prin a include spațiul de nume Aspose.Words în proiectul dvs. JavaScript. Apoi, specificați calea către fișierul de intrare și creați un obiect Document pentru a încărca conținutul MHTML. Apoi trebuie să specificați calea către fișierul de ieșire PDF și să utilizați metoda save() pentru a salva rezultatul ca PDF. API-ul de conversie va determina formatul fișierului de ieșire pe baza extensiei de fișier specificate.
npm install @aspose/words
Copie
const aw = require('@aspose/words');
var doc = new aw.Document("Input.mhtml")
doc.save("Output.pdf")
const aw = require('@aspose/words');
var doc = new aw.Document("Input.mhtml")
doc.save("Output.pdf")
const aw = require('@aspose/words');
var doc = new aw.Document("Input.mhtml")
for (var page = 0; page < doc.pageCount; page++) {
var extractedPage = doc.extractPages(page, 1);
extractedPage.save(`Output_${page + 1}.pdf`);
}
const aw = require('@aspose/words');
var doc = new aw.Document()
var builder = new aw.DocumentBuilder(doc)
builder.insertImage("Input.mhtml")
doc.save("Output.pdf")
const aw = require('@aspose/words');
var doc = new aw.Document()
var builder = new aw.DocumentBuilder(doc)
shape = builder.insertImage("Input.mhtml")
shape.getShapeRenderer().save("Output.pdf", new aw.Saving.ImageSaveOptions(aw.SaveFormat.pdf))
We host our Node.js via .Net packages in NPM repositories. Please follow the step-by-step instructions on how to install "Aspose.Words for Node.js via .NET" to your developer environment.
This package is compatible with Node.js 14.17.0 or higher.
Puteți converti MHTML în multe alte formate de fișiere: